Fair Play is one of California's newest recognized wine growing regions, a small district in the foothills of the Sierra Nevada, just south of Placerville. Jonathan and Susan Marks saw the potential of Fair Play for growing the robust reds and rich white wines they love, and their vision has paid off in the excellent wines they produce from their estate vineyards. Having followed this winery from its first vintage in 1998, for me their zinfandel remains their most consistent and delicious red among the several varietals that they grow, full of rich ripe fruit that is spicy with black pepper and cedar notes. A touch of earthiness is typical of Sierra Foothills Zinfandels, but Cedarville's version is neither overly extracted or too dense to work with food. A real Zinfandel-lovers Zinfandel, and one of the best from this exciting new California terroir.
